Prep Time 25 minutes Cook Time 50 minutes 0 minutes Total Time 1 hour 15 minutes Servings 4 Servings
Ingredients
Meatballs:
1 pound ground beef or lamb or combination
1/2 onion grated
2 garlic cloves grated
2 teaspoons paprika
1 teaspoon cumin
1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
1/4 teaspoon hot paprika
1/4 cup parsley finely minced
1/4 cup cilantro finely minced
salt and pepper to taste
Sauce:
Olive oil or ghee for pan
1 onion thinly sliced or chopped
2 (14.5 ounce) cans diced tomatoes
3 cloves garlic minced
2 teaspoons cumin
1 1/2 teaspoons paprika
1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
1/2 teaspoon hot paprika
3 tablespoons chopped parsley
3 tablespoons chopped cilantro
4 eggs
Instructions
In a medium bowl, combine ground meat, grated onion, garlic, paprika, cumin, cinnamon, hot paprika, salt, pepper, parsley, and cilantro. Use your hands to roll the mixture into 3/4 inch round meatballs.
Drizzle olive oil or ghee over bottom of tagine or deep skillet with tight fitting lid over medium heat. A diffuser is needed for clay tagines. Add the sliced onion and cook until soft. Sprinkle with minced garlic and place meatballs in a mostly single layer over onions. Cook, gently stirring occasionally, until brown on sides.
Pour in enough tomatoes to mostly cover the meatballs. Add the cumin, paprika, cinnamon, hot paprika, and gently stir to combine. Cover, reduce heat to low, and let simmer for 30 minutes.
Remove cover, crack eggs into separate areas among the meatballs, and sprinkle with parsley, cilantro, salt, and pepper. Cover again and cook until eggs are barely set, 7-10 minutes.
Most of us don’t think twice about drinking a glass of water. But a report released Wednesday though, found more than 270 harmful contaminants in local drinking water across the nation. The substances are linked to cancer, damage to the brain and nervous system, hormonal disruption, problems in pregnancy and other serious health conditions.
So I decided to check out my tap water through this link to retrieve information for my specific area by zip code https://www.ewg.org/tapwater/.
Here were my results! Yikes! In my local tapwater, the group found 23 contaminants across our water supply between 2012 and 2017. (which serves ~172,000 people).
Regarding the study:
“The nonprofit Environmental Working Group, collaborating with outside scientists, aggregated and analyzed data from almost 50,000 local water utilities in all 50 states. Read more on the Environmental Working Group’s data sources and methodology. The organization found a troubling discrepancy between the current legal limits for contaminants and the most recent authoritative studies of what is safe to consume. “Legal does not necessarily equal safe.”
In the case of polyfluorinated substances, or PFAs, the environmental group estimated up to 110 million Americans could have the potentially cancer-causing, immune-system damaging contaminant in their drinking water. Yet the EPA requires drinking water utilities across the country to test for only six of 14 known substances in the category.
A variety of other contaminants often found in the water of millions of Americans can profoundly impact health. They include lead, which has been linked to brain damage in small children; arsenic, which can cause cancer; and copper, which can be harmful to infants.
According to the environmental group, many of the 270-plus contaminants detected through water sampling are at levels deemed legal under the federal Safe Drinking Water Act, yet are above levels that recent studies have found to pose possible health risks.

Throw together a deliciously spiced and super healthy dish in no time flat. This recipe is great as a side dish or vegetarian meal.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ings 4 people
Calories 472 cal
Ingredients
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 medium red onion chopped
1 yellow bell pepper chopped
1 carrot chopped into cubes
2 cloves garlic minced
salt & pepper to taste
½ teaspoon paprika
½ teaspoon ground coriander
¼ teaspoon turmeric
½ teaspoon celery salt
½ teaspoon ground cumin
⅛ teaspoon ground cinnamon
cayenne pepper optional, to taste
1 cup frozen peas
1 14oz can chickpeas drained
6 Peppadew Piquante peppers chopped, mild or hot
1½ cups chicken stock or vegetable stock
A good handful fresh parsley chopped
1 cup instant couscous
Instructions
In a medium-size skillet heat the oil over medium heat.
Add red onion, yellow pepper, and carrot sauté 10-15 minutes or until all the vegetables are your desired tenderness
Add the garlic, sauté another minute.
Mix in the salt & pepper, paprika, ground coriander, turmeric, celery salt, cumin ground cinnamon, and cayenne pepper (if using). Stir-fry until fragrant (about a minute).
Add the frozen peas and cook briefly. Stir in the piquante peppers and chickpeas. Followed by the stock.
Add the chopped parsley and stir in the couscous. Remove from heat and let stand 5 minutes or until liquid is absorbed. Fluff and serve.
Notes
This recipe calls for instant couscous. Instant couscous is cooked by covering it with water and leaving it to sit for 5 minutes.
Read the package instructions for your couscous. If the directions and measurements, do not match the recipe instructions, just adjust the liquid measurement according to the amount of couscous in the recipe, add the spices and follow then follow the package instructions. Once cooked, add the vegetables and mix to combine.

What’s for dinner tonight. Low Carb Mexican – Chicken Enchilada Stuffed Peppers! These were fabulous! I had to make them again and try it with a little beef. They could also be done without any meat, just increase the beans so you are still getting enough protein!
Ingredients:
3 medium bell peppers, any color
2 cups cooked and shredded chicken (I baked it while prepping the other ingredients)
1 (10oz) can enchilada sauce
1 (4oz) can diced green chiles
1/2 cup frozen corn
1/2 cup black beans, drained and rinsed
1/4 cup fresh cilantro, finely chopped
1 tsp cumin
1/2 tsp garlic powder
1/2 tsp salt
1/2 tsp chili powder
1 cup shredded Monterrey Jack cheese, divided
1/4 cup chicken broth or water
Instructions
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Spray a large baking dish with cooking spray and set aside.
Remove stems from peppers, slice iin half lengthwise and scrap out membranes and seeds. Set aside
In a large bowl, combine the chicken, enchilada sauce, green chiles, corn, black beans, cilantro, cumin, garlic powder, salt, chili powder and 1/2 cup of the cheese. Mix together
Pour chicken broth into the bottom of the prepared pan. Spoon the chicken enchilada filling evenly into the pepper halfs and place in the baking dish. Sprinkle the remaining 1/2 cheese over the top of the stuffed peppers.
Cover the pan with aluminum foil and bake in the preheated oven for 45 minutes. Remove aluminum foil and return to the oven to bake for an additional 10-15 minutes until peppers are soft and the cheese is melted. Serve with your favorite toppings, such as sour cream, diced avacado, dices tomato, and chopped cilantro. Enjoy!
